Give a simple test to distinguish between : (i) Pentan-2-one and Pentan-3-one. , (ii) Benzaldehyde and acetophenone.

Answer» (i) Pentan-2-one is methyl ketone, It gives iodoform test (yellow ppt.) Pentan-3-one does not respond to this test since it is not a methyl ketone.
(ii) Acetophenone `(C_(6)H_(5)COCH_(3))` being a methyl ketone responds to iodoform test (yellow ppt.).Benzaldehyde `(C_(6)H_(5)CHO)` does not given this test.

In the preparation of aldehydes from primary alcohols, adehydes formed must be distilled as soon as they are formed. Why ?

Answer» Aldehydes formed as a result of the oxidation of primary alcohols are prone t o further oxidation and are expected to form acids. Therefore, it is advisable to remove them form the reaction mixture by distillation in case these are low boiling. Otherwise other methods must be used to convert primary alcohols into aldehydes.

Dialkyl cadmium is used to prepare ketones from acid chlorides and not from Grignard reagents. Assign reason.

Answer» Grigard reagents do from ketones with acid chlorides but the reactions does not stop at this stage. Ketones further takes part in the reactions with Grignard reagents to give tertiary alcohols. Therefore, dialkyl cadmium is used which reacts with only the acid chlorides and not with ketones.

Out of benzaldehyde and propionaldehyde, which is mre reactive towards nucelophilic addition?

Answer» Propionadehyde is more reactive than benzaldehyde towards nucleophilic addition. Actually, in benzaldehyde the aldehyic group has -M (mesomeric) effect. As a result the electron density on the carbonyl carbon atom tends to increase and the nucleophile attack is more difficult as compared to propionaldehyde where alkyl group is attached to the aldehydic group.
